उपदिष्टः सद्गुरुणा जप्तः क्षेत्रे च पावने । सद्यो यथेप्सितां सिद्धिं ददातीति किमद्भुतम्
upadiṣṭaḥ sadguruṇā japtaḥ kṣetre ca pāvane | sadyo yathepsitāṃ siddhiṃ dadātīti kimadbhutam
真のサッドグルによって授けられ、清めの聖地にてジャパとして唱えられるなら、望む成就をただちに与える—そこに何の不思議があろうか。

Mantra bears swift fruit when received through authentic guidance and practiced in sanctified sacred geography.
The verse praises the principle of a ‘pāvana kṣetra’ generally; named tīrthas are listed subsequently.
Receive the mantra from a sadguru and perform japa in a purifying sacred place (kṣetra).
